Hey,

I have a new gigabit router. hoped that speeds to copy files TO my gigabit ReadyNASNV+ would drastically improve.

Have been testing

Peak transfer rate using AFP = 25 MB/s
Peak transfer rate using NFS = 10 MB/s
FTP peak rate was 15 MB/s

and

Moving files from my iMac to my NAS using FW external drive Rate = 28 MB/s about the same as AFP over gigabit using cat5

I was curious as to why NFS is slower than AFP ? Seemingly not taking advantage of the gigabit line.
I use NFS to auto-mount my NAS on my AppleTV with the help of ATVFiles

so

anyone comment on NFS speeds over ethernet AND whether I should be using a cat6 cable.
the AFP speeds doubled using the gigabit line - even using a cat5 cable ?

People in the know have told me that cat5 should be fine for gigabit line. So my question is :

Why doesn't NFS take advantage of the gigabit line ? It stays at the same transfer rate as with 10/100.
